Pentacare Guggulu Ghanavati is an Ayurvedic formulation often used for its cholesterol-lowering properties and to support the reduction of Kapha-related issues like weight gain and joint stiffness. The main active ingredient, Guggulu, is known to help balance lipid levels and improve metabolism, which makes it a good candidate for managing high cholesterol and supporting weight management. It works largely by enhancing Agni, or digestive fire, helping your body process fats more effectively.
When considering taking Pentacare Guggulu Ghanavati, it’s best to take it after meals to support digestion and absorption. Usually, a common dosage can be one tablet twice a day, but it would be wise to consult with a qualified Ayurvedic practitioner to customize the dosage based on your individual Prakriti—your unique body constitution.
For your joint issues, this formulation might offer some relief by reducing inflammation and aiding in the removal of toxins from the body, which could be contributing to Achy knees. However, consistency is key with Ayurvedic remedies, so regular use over a few weeks to months may be necessary to notice improvements.
As with any supplement, you should be aware of potential interactions, especially if you’re on other medications. Guggulu has blood-thinning properties, so if you are taking anticoagulants or have bleeding disorders, you should exercise caution.
Side effects are generally rare with Ayurvedic formulations but can include mild gastrointestinal upset for some individuals. It’s noteworthy that taking too high a dosage can lead to imbalances in Pitta, manifesting as overheating, heartburn, or even skin rashes.
